Zacks picks Duke Energy over Constellation Energy on valuation, yield, and momentum

Zacks Investment Research says Duke Energy currently has an edge over Constellation Energy, citing stronger earnings estimate momentum, a higher dividend yield, a larger capital investment plan, a cheaper valuation, and better recent share price performance. Duke Energy carries a Zacks Rank #2 (Buy), while Constellation Energy holds a Zacks Rank #3 (Hold). Duke Energy’s forward 12-month price-to-earnings ratio stands at 18.54 times, below Constellation Energy’s 20.46 times and the S&P 500’s 23.15 times. Duke Energy’s dividend yield is 3.32 percent versus Constellation Energy’s 0.65 percent, and Duke Energy shares have gained 9 percent over the past six months while Constellation Energy has declined 27.4 percent. Duke Energy plans to spend 103 billion dollars on capital investments from 2026 through 2030, while Constellation Energy expects to invest about 5.7 billion dollars in 2026 and 4.7 billion dollars in 2027. Constellation Energy’s return on equity is 16.81 percent compared with Duke Energy’s 9.73 percent.
